Probably more of a 3.5 for me but rounding up because the service was fairly solid. I ordered the spicy seafood noodles, expecting it to be kind of like a Korean jjamppong. It was roughly that general idea give or take. I didn't like how they used thin rice noodles in the soup -- I'm definitely a wide and flat noodle kind of person, especially when it comes to spicy seafood noodle soup. They were fairly generous on the amount of seafood and beef. The dish wasn't particularly spicy overall and was really dominated by mushroom flavor which I didn't like as much -- wish it had been more seafood/beef oriented. Price was a little on the high end as well. I tried a bit of my friend's drunken noodle dish and it was far inferior to the drunken noodles we had at a hole in the wall in Healy a couple of days prior. If you're looking for Asian food in Kodiak, I'd probably go to Kodiak Hana instead.

We came here on the last night of our visit to Kodiak and I wish we had come here earlier so we could've come here more than once. It is a lot more spacious inside than it looks from the outside. The menu offers Thai, Chinese, Korean and even a few Vietnamese dishes like pho. We got the pineapple fried rice and the stone bowl bi bin bop (mixed rice) and both were delicious! The portions are a good size and this would be a great place if you have a bigger group because you can share the plates. Service was great and this place is quite a gem and we are so glad we came before leaving!

Visiting clients in Kodiak and everywhere we called were booked but Noodles had some Space available for our party of 7. Luckily everything is close so we were there in no time. Loved the variety of Asian food on the menu. Between everyone at our table, there was Chinese, Vietnamese, Japanese and Korean dishes ordered. Service was pretty good considering they only had two servers in a packed restaurant. I personally ordered the Bibimbap in a stone dish which was out of this word delicious. The kids around our table where Amazed to watch me crack an egg at the table into my dish and stir it in. What a fun place. For the limited options on the island, this is a great choice.
